TCPIP协议简要论文及分析.docx
毕业设计(论文)
PAGE
1-
毕业设计(论文)报告
题目:
TCPIP协议简要论文及分析
学号:
姓名:
学院:
专业:
指导教师:
起止日期:
TCPIP协议简要论文及分析
摘要:TCP/IP协议作为互联网的基础协议,自诞生以来,经历了多次的迭代与优化。本文旨在对TCP/IP协议进行简要概述,分析其工作原理、协议层次结构以及各个层次的主要功能。通过对TCP/IP协议的深入研究,本文揭示了其在网络通信中的重要作用,并探讨了其在未来网络发展中的趋势。
随着信息技术的飞速发展,互联网已经成为人们生活中不可或缺的一部分。网络通信作为互联网的核心功能,其性能和稳定性直接影响到用户的体验。TCP/IP协议作为互联网的基础协议,承载着全球范围内的数据传输任务。本文从TCP/IP协议的起源、发展历程、协议结构等方面入手,对TCP/IP协议进行深入剖析,以期为我国网络通信技术的发展提供有益的参考。
一、TCP/IP协议概述
1.1TCP/IP协议的起源与发展
(1)TCP/IP协议的起源可以追溯到20世纪60年代,当时互联网的雏形刚刚形成。美国国防部的高级研究计划署(ARPA)为了确保在战争情况下信息的稳定传输,启动了一个名为ARPANET的项目。ARPANET项目的目标是通过一种名为网络层协议(NetworkLayerProtocol)的技术,实现不同类型计算机之间的数据交换。这一协议后来演变成了TCP/IP协议的核心部分。在1969年,ARPANET的首次成功连接标志着TCP/IP协议发展的起点。
(2)随着20世纪70年代互联网的快速发展,TCP/IP协议逐渐成为互联网的标准化协议。1973年,VintCerf和BobKahn共同提出了TCP/IP协议的初步设计方案,这一设计将网络通信分解为四个层次:网络接口层、网络层、传输层和应用层。这种分层的设计理念使得TCP/IP协议具有很高的灵活性和可扩展性。随后,TCP/IP协议被广泛应用于ARPANET以外的网络,并在1983年成为ARPANET的官方通信协议。
(3)进入20世纪90年代,互联网进入了一个高速发展阶段。TCP/IP协议不断进行优化和升级,以满足日益增长的网络需求。1995年,IPv4协议正式成为互联网的官方协议,标志着TCP/IP协议的成熟。然而,随着互联网用户的爆炸式增长和物联网的兴起,IPv4地址资源逐渐紧张。为了应对这一挑战,IPv6协议应运而生,并于2011年正式启用。IPv6协议采用128位地址长度,极大地扩展了地址资源,为互联网的长期发展提供了保障。
1.2TCP/IP协议的层次结构
(1)TCP/IP协议的层次结构是按照功能进行划分的,它将网络通信分解为四个主要层次:网络接口层、网络层、传输层和应用层。网络接口层负责处理物理网络介质上的数据传输,包括以太网、Wi-Fi等。这一层负责将数据帧从网络层接收,并将其发送到物理介质上。
(2)网络层是TCP/IP协议的核心层次之一,它负责在互联网中寻址和路由数据包。网络层使用IP协议(InternetProtocol)来为数据包分配唯一的IP地址,并确保数据包能够从源主机到达目标主机。网络层还负责数据包的分片和重组,以便在传输过程中跨越不同类型的网络。
(3)传输层负责提供端到端的数据传输服务,它确保数据包的可靠性和顺序。TCP(传输控制协议)和UDP(用户数据报协议)是传输层的两个主要协议。TCP提供面向连接的服务,确保数据包的顺序和完整性;而UDP提供无连接的服务,适用于实时通信和不需要数据完整性的应用。传输层还负责流量控制和拥塞控制,以优化网络性能。
1.3TCP/IP协议的主要功能
(1)TCP/IP协议的主要功能之一是确保数据传输的可靠性。以TCP协议为例,它通过三次握手建立连接,确保数据包的有序传输。例如,在2019年的一项研究中,通过对全球范围内超过1000个网站进行测试,发现使用TCP协议的网站中,有98%的数据传输成功率达到99%以上。这表明TCP协议在保证数据传输可靠性方面发挥了重要作用。
(2)TCP/IP协议还负责数据包的路由和寻址。IP协议通过IP地址为每个设备分配唯一的标识符,使得数据包能够在复杂的网络环境中找到正确的路径。例如,在2020年的一项调查中,全球互联网上的IP地址数量已经超过340亿个,这得益于IP协议的灵活性和可扩展性。以亚马逊云服务为例,其全球数据中心通过IP协议实现了高效的数据传输和访问。
(3)TCP/IP协议还提供了端到端的数据传输服务,支持多种应用层协议。例如,HTTP协议(超文本传输协议)是TCP/IP协议在应用层的一个典型应用,它使得Web浏览成为可能。据统计,截至2021